What If Viagra Does Not Work?
Studies show that Viagra works for 4 out of 5 men and in some cases it will need to be taken 3 to 4 times prior to it working with the results that are expected. There is also the possibility that the dosage being taken needs to be changed by the physician, not every person’s system is the same. Some people require higher dosages of medications than others; this is not a problem when it involves Viagra since it can be prescribed in 25 mg, 50 mg, or 100 mg.
This of course also depends on other medications or health issues the patient might have when prescribing higher doses of the FDA approved medication. Lower dosages might be prescribed for men taking certain types of medication so there will not be a drug interaction.
When Viagra does not work the first time and if there are still problems occurring after it has been taken on several different occasions, speaking to the doctor can clear this problem up with the prescription for a higher dosage. While this is an uncommon event, Viagra studies show that the medication does work for male impotency for most men.
